Lego Is Going Back To The ’90s With These X-Files And Wallace & Gromit Sets

Lego has unveiled the upcoming sets, which are the brainchild of fan designers who contributed to its Ideas program. These new releases feature beloved FBI agents from The X-Files, iconic moments from an unforgettable Simpsons episode involving a stolen whale storyline, and Wallace & Gromit.

From among the entries submitted to the Lego Ideas “Revisit the ’90s: A Nostalgic Tribute” competition, these two designs were selected. This competition asked designers to capture the spirit of the ’90s with their unique creations. Although the first Wallace & Gromit short aired in 1989, we’re focusing on the two shorts that were made during the ’90s. The X-Files embodies everything that was iconic about the ’90s, much like ripped jeans and grunge music. In due time, these two sets will join a miniature version of Godzilla.

The X-Files set was crafted by WetWired, showcasing FBI agents Mulder and Scully within a forest scene, complete with a UFO spacecraft, an alien, and a replica of Mulder’s famous office. The truth, it seems, lies hidden up above! Additionally, you’ll find a few extra minifigures in this collection, such as FBI assistant director Skinner, the infamous Jersey Devil, and Eugene Tooms from the episodes that kept us awake at night.

In the creation by Pidelium, known as the Wallace & Gromit submission, they’ve constructed a miniature replica of the renowned British inventor and his faithful dog using bricks. This miniature scene is inspired by the short film “A Close Shave” from 1995. It showcases the duo, their motorbike, and the tools they use in their window-cleaning enterprise. However, no cheese is present in this setup.

Just a heads-up, there may be differences between the fan designs and the actual products once they hit the shelves. You’ll have to wait a bit until they become available for purchase.
